5.0 out of 5 stars Simple, practical, and specific, August 29, 2007
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
I first ran across this book in the library of a retreat center when I was on a self-guided prayer retreat, and was so delighted with it that I decided to order a copy of my own. Covering the basics for a direct healing prayer ministry, the book will allow either individuals or teams to ramp up even when they're just getting started. MacNutt, more than many other writers on prayer, highlights the reality of gradual healing when oral, spontaneous prayer is applied repeatedly over a period of time, and identifies specific techniques besides just words that help to communicate the prayer to the one being prayed for.

While MacNutt is a Catholic, Protestant and Orthodox believers will find this book helpful too.
